Description
Our annex, known as 'The Garage' is within walking distance of the delightful town of Wimborne. It is 10 miles from Poole and Bournemouth, close to beaches, countryside, national trust property and airport. It is attached to the main house but has a separate entrance. It's ideal for a couple of nights stay. It is small and cosy with a kitchenette, drawers, table and chairs, toilet, shower and a double bed. It has underfloor heating for the winter months. Parking available on the drive. The space Our modern, cosy annex is an ideal stop over for a night of two. It has a double bed and a bedside chair. There is a kitchen sink with draining board. as well as a microwave, toaster, kettle and fridge. In the cupboards there are crockery and cutlery. to enable you to make a simple meal. A shower room with shower, toilet and basin as well as shampoo, conditioner and soap. Tea , coffee, sugar, milk and biscuits are provided. Guest access Parking on the drive, directly outside 'The Garage' is available as well as free parking outside on the quiet road. 50m way from 'The Garage' are bus stops taking you to Wimborne, Poole and Bournemouth. During your stay Our annex ' The Garage' has it's own entrance and a key lock box so you can come and go as you please. If we are around then we will meet you but otherwise we can be contacted by phone. There is a microwave, kettle, mini fridge and toaster as well as tea, coffee, milk and biscuits. A small Co-op is s short walk away where all provisions can be bought as well, as a offering a post office. Inside is a folder with information about local eateries and places of interest/dog walks. If you bring bikes then we have a shed around the back where we can store them securely. Bus stops to Wimborne, Poole and Bournemouth are within 100 meters of the annex. Beaches are all within 20 minutes drive. Other things to note The annex is attached to our house and so you can very occasionally hear chatting from the main house or garden. Guests are able to bring their dogs so very occasionally dog hairs may be found - however the cleaners do their very best to remove them. The annex is a short distance from the local Co-op shop which provides both food and drink as well as having a very handy post office.
